Cold buffets are always popular as they are flexible and don’t rely on all your guests being seated at once. All the food is prepared in Sue’s kitchen and delivered to you on serving dishes.

Sue has created a broad menu from which you can tailor your own buffet for 8 – 80 guests.

If a dish you would particularly like is not listed – please ask, and Sue will do her best to incorporate it into your menu.

If you, or any of your guests, have any particular culinary likes, dislikes or allergies, do let Sue know in advance so that she can use appropriate ingredients.

Dishes marked * contain raw or lightly cooked egg.

Extras

Waitresses at £11 per hour per waitress, £16.50 after midnight.

Crockery, cutlery and glasses at £3.00 per person.

Tableclothes, linen or paper napkins on request.
